Why Is a Replacement Battery Necessary for the Lenovo ThinkPad T430?

A replacement battery is necessary for the Lenovo ThinkPad T430 to ensure continued portability and functionality. A degraded or dead battery prevents the laptop from operating away from a power source.

According to the Battery University, a reputable authority on battery technology, laptop batteries degrade over time due to chemical reactions inside them. This natural aging process reduces battery life and efficiency.

The underlying causes of needing a replacement battery include wear and tear, temperature exposure, and usage patterns. As lithium-ion batteries age, their capacity diminishes. Regular discharge and recharge cycles contribute to this degradation. Environmental conditions, such as high temperatures, can accelerate battery wear.

Lithium-ion batteries, commonly used in laptops, contain components like an anode, cathode, and electrolyte. During charging, lithium ions move from the anode to the cathode. Over time, the chemical reactions creating these movements become less efficient. This diminished efficiency results in shorter battery life and eventual failure.

Specific actions contribute to battery degradation. Frequent deep discharges—where the battery is drained almost completely—can wear it out faster. High operating temperatures, such as using the laptop on soft surfaces that hinder ventilation, can also harm the battery. For instance, using the laptop plugged in continuously may result in the battery remaining at a high state of charge for prolonged periods, which can shorten its lifespan.

What Specifications Must a Replacement Battery Meet for Optimal Functionality?

A replacement battery must meet specific specifications to ensure optimal functionality in devices such as laptops and smartphones.

  1. Voltage rating
  2. Capacity (mAh or Ah)
  3. Chemistry type
  4. Size and form factor
  5. Connector type
  6. Cycle life
  7. Temperature range
  8. Safety certifications

In considering these specifications, it is important to dive into the details of each aspect to understand their relevance and impact.

  1. Voltage Rating: The voltage rating of a replacement battery indicates the potential difference it can provide. This rating must match the original battery’s voltage to ensure proper function. For example, if a laptop battery is rated at 11.1 volts, using a battery with a different voltage can cause malfunction or damage the device.

  2. Capacity (mAh or Ah): Capacity measures the battery’s energy storage abilities and is typically expressed in milliampere-hours (mAh) or ampere-hours (Ah). A higher capacity means longer usage time between charges. For instance, a battery with 5000 mAh will provide more extended performance in a device than one with 3000 mAh, thus enhancing user satisfaction.

  3. Chemistry Type: The chemistry type pertains to the materials and chemical reactions used in the battery. Common types include Lithium-ion (Li-ion) and Nickel-Metal Hydride (NiMH). Li-ion batteries are favored in modern applications due to their high energy density and lower self-discharge rates. According to research by Nagaiah et al. (2019), Li-ion batteries also offer longer cycle life compared to other types.

  4. Size and Form Factor: The size and form factor of the replacement battery must align with the device’s battery compartment. This ensures a snug fit and proper contact with the device’s power connectors. Utilizing a battery that does not fit properly can lead to operational issues or physical damage to the device.

  5. Connector Type: The connector type determines how the battery interfaces with the device. Different devices may have unique connector styles and arrangements. For instance, a laptop may require a specific connector shape that allows for secure connection. Using an incompatible connector can hinder the battery’s ability to charge or power the device.

  6. Cycle Life: Cycle life refers to the number of complete charge and discharge cycles a battery can undergo before its capacity significantly declines. A higher cycle life indicates a longer lifespan for the battery. Studies have shown that a cycle life of 500-1000 cycles is standard for many Li-ion batteries (Rourke, 2020).

  7. Temperature Range: The operational temperature range illustrates the environments in which the battery can function effectively. Batteries often have specific temperature thresholds to prevent overheating or freezing. A battery that operates outside its designated temperature range may suffer from performance issues or damage.

  8. Safety Certifications: Safety certifications indicate that the battery has met industry standards for safety and quality. Common safety certifications include UL, CE, and RoHS. These certifications ensure that the battery has undergone testing for potential hazards, including overheating and short-circuiting, thereby protecting users and devices from incidents.

Understanding these specifications will help users make informed decisions about replacement batteries for optimal performance and longevity.
